The Doris Mollel Foundation is replicating its Kwimba NCU model Tanzania’s first government-integrated neonatal unit in Zanzibar. In the South District, birth complications are rising, yet there is no dedicated center equipped to handle specialized neonatal care. We are scaling our blueprint to construct permanent, high-standard facilities featuring High Dependency Units and Kangaroo Mother Care wards.
